- WDC: 8 x 10 - Through a grant from the DC Commission on the Arts & Humanities, I photographed 8 different parks throughout Washington, DC (one park for each ward). Collectively, the series of 64 photographs creates a portrait of the city.
- Hiroshima - In 2004, I received a fellowship to travel to Hiroshima and Nagasaki Japan, and atted the World Conference Against A & H Bombs. Upon my return, my photographs from Hiroshima were exhibited at Martin Luther King, Jr. Library in Washington, DC, St. Mark's School in Southborough, MA and Lesley College in Cambridge, MA. I continue to look for opportunities to use these photographs educationally.
